Local experiences: food, markets, culture, and day trips

Corsica is a treasure chest of flavors, crafts, and stories, and Santa-Lucia-di-Moriani is a fantastic place to dive into the local experience. Corsican cuisine leans into rustic, flavorful dishes and seasonal ingredients. A typical day might include a morning market run for fresh brocciu cheese (a Corsican staple), olives, citrus, and crusty bread, followed by a lunch of grilled seafood and figatellu sausage. In the evenings, you can explore a coastal tavern where the menu features local specialties such as fish caught that day, octopus salad, and hearty stews warmed by herbs and garlic. For a true Corsican dessert, try canistrelli biscuits dusted with sugar or a homemade honey pastry that pairs beautifully with a late-night espresso or a glass of local wine.

To deepen the experience, consider a guided tasting at a nearby winery to sample Corsican varietals, such as Vermentino or Nielluccio, with a view of the vines that roll toward the hills. If you’re open to a cultural day trip, a visit to nearby Bastia or Corte offers a glimpse into Corsican history, architecture, and traditional crafts. These towns host markets, artisan shops, and small museums that give you a sense of the island’s deep-rooted heritage. Seasonality, best times to visit, and what to expect

Corsica has a delightful climate, with hot summers perfect for beach lounging and mild shoulder seasons that offer fewer crowds and plenty of daylight for outdoor activities. Santa-Lucia-di-Moriani blooms in the late spring through early autumn, with July and August bringing the most beach-friendly weather. If you’re traveling with friends who want a balance of sun and exploration, late May to early June and September are ideal windows. The sea stays delightfully warm, the villages remain welcoming, and the markets are vibrant without the peak-season crush.
